
POLARIS - 14K Yellow Gold - Model 505. Starting in 1945 Hamilton awarded
gold watches to all employees on the occasion of their 15 year of continuous employment.
Each watch was engraved with a custom dedication reading "To a Craftsman the
Product of His Craft. Presented to ... For Long and Loyal Service. Hamilton Watch
Co. [year]". Needless to say these award watches are excessively rare since
the only way to acquire one was to devote 15 years of dedicated service to the Hamilton
company. Each employee had a choice of two watches. In the Electric era one choice
was mechanical, the other Electric -- the Spectra for the first 3 years, the Polaris
until 1964, and the Polaris II thereafter. This Polaris was given to an employee
in 1960.

First released on January 3, 1957, the Ventura was the world's first battery-powered watch, and it remains one of the most popular watch styles even after 50 years. As conceived by renowned designer Richard Arbib and first marketed by Hamilton
in early 1957, the "Ventura" Electric was offered with a unique strap with
a stripe of gold alongside a stripe of black, complementing the stunning design of
the case and dial. However within only about four months Hamilton discontinued this
custom strap and replaced it with a conventional black strap to reduce manufacturing
costs. The few straps that were sold in 1957 have almost all worn out and today these
original straps are incredibly rare and valuable. Those few that do exist are usually
so brittle from age that they are not wearable.

(left) EVEREST - Model 500. One of the most popular of the Hamilton Electrics, the Everest has become surprisingly scarce in recent years. It has a very bold design in which the keystone-shaped center portion gives the illusion of breaking through the top of the case. The numbers marked on the top of the bezel and the bright gold center of the dial reinforce the optical illusion. "ELVIS" LIMITED EDITION VENTURAS. In honor of Elvis Presley's 75th
birthday coming up in 2010, Hamilton has released a pair of special limited edition
Venturas with vintage-style "scissor-link" stretch metal bands. Although
Hamilton never originally offered the Ventura with a metal band, Elvis chose to wear
his personal white gold Ventura with a matching stretch band. The photograph at the
top shows his watch, as purchased by Elvis in 1965. (It was sold at auction by Graceland
about 10 years ago, and was bought back by the Hamilton Watch Company for its own
collection.) Elvis evidently didn't like the leather strap that came with the watch,
so the jeweler swapped out a metal band from a white gold-filled Savitar II in order
to keep his famous customer happy.
For the Elvis birthday Venturas Hamilton
has created the most accurate replicas they have made to date. The case is extremely
well crafted and matches the original much more closely than the standard Ventura
reissue as shown at the bottom of this page. The dial is also more like the original,
with gloss black finsh and a domed shape. Two versions are available. The plain stainless
steel Elvis Ventura is a close visual match to Elvis' original white gold watch.
For those who prefer yellow gold, Hamilton has also produced a Ventura plated in
yellow with the latest PVD plating technology, giving a much harder and more durable
finish than old electroplating.
